Christy first moved to Thailand with her parents at the age of six, living in Khorat and then in Bangkok.
She released her first album, Christy Der Ka Der (This is Christy), in 2001, and her second, Jam Gan Boh Dai Gah? in 2002. Her third album is Gulahp Wiang Ping. She has also recorded an album jointly with Swedish luk tung singer Jonas Anderson, called Rum-tone, Rum-thai.
